Prime Meaning

There are 12 meaning(s) for word Prime

Meaning 1 : being at the best stage of development

    Example : our manhood's prime vigor

    Synonyms : meridian
Meaning 2 : the time of maturity when power and vigor are greatest

    Synonyms : prime of life
Meaning 3 : cover with a primer; apply a primer to

    Synonyms : ground,  undercoat
Meaning 4 : the period of greatest prosperity or productivity

    Synonyms : bloom,  blossom,  efflorescence,  flower,  flush,  heyday,  peak
Meaning 5 : a natural number that has exactly two distinct natural number divisors: 1 and itself

    Synonyms : prime quantity
Meaning 6 : first in rank or degree

    Example : the prime minister

    Synonyms : premier
Meaning 7 : of superior grade

    Example : prime beef

    Synonyms : choice,  prize,  quality,  select
Meaning 8 : fill with priming liquid

    Example : prime a car engine

Meaning 9 : insert a primer into (a gun, mine, or charge) preparatory to detonation or firing

    Example : prime a cannon,prime a mine

Meaning 10 : of or relating to or being an integer that cannot be factored into other integers

    Example : prime number

Meaning 11 : the second canonical hour; about 6 a.m.

Meaning 12 : used of the first or originating agent

    Example : prime mover
